But First, What Is a “Funnel”?
Your funnel is simply how people move from never hearing about you to becoming a paying customer.
It’s how you:
Gain awareness
Attract website visitors
Turn visitors into leads
Book sales calls
Land new clients
Miss one stage, and everything downstream suffers.
The Five Funnel Stages
Here’s how I build a funnel that works at every stage:
1. Awareness: Attract Strangers
Invest in SEO early. You’re buying “Internet real estate” that pays you for years.
The goal isn’t just traffic. It’s relevant traffic from people actively looking for what you offer.
2. Interest: Engage Prospects
Offer something valuable: consultations, ebooks, webinars, or tools. Don’t let traffic leave without a clear next step.
A clear offer makes it easy for prospects to engage and turns anonymous visitors into leads you can build relationships with.

3. Consideration: Nurture Leads
Build trust with case studies, testimonials, trials, and real conversations. People buy when people feel confident.
Most leads aren’t ready to buy yet. That’s normal.
Consistent education and proof help them move from “interested” to “ready” without pressure.
4. Conversion: Turn Leads Into Customers
Win deals with fast response times, personalization, and compelling offers. Speed and revelevance matters more than people think.
Also, small improvements here, like adding a limited-time bonus, can create big revenue gains.
5. Retention: Keep Customers Coming Back
Keep customers with great support, referral rewards, and genuinely caring about their needs.
Happy customers naturally become advocates. They buy again and refer others, which is where sustainable growth really starts.
